A ceramic figurine inspired by the Disney Studios animated film "Lady and the Tramp" (1955). Featuring Trusty the Bloodhound in a seated position, the figurine was manufactured after the film's release by Californian ceramist, Evan K. Shaw Pottery. Through the 1940s and 1950s, the Evan K. Shaw Pottery company and its sister companies, Metlox and American Pottery, produced a wide range of ceramics. In 1943, they were granted approval as a licensee to produce a range of Disney characters. These companies are no longer in business, and their highly desirable figurines are increasingly rare. Measuring 1.25"x1.75" and 2.75" tall, the figurine is in very good condition with wear due to age and handling, and some minor crazing.
